[PATCH net-next] cfg80211: regulatory: use DEFINE_SPINLOCK() for spinlock

spinlock can be initialized automatically with DEFINE_SPINLOCK()
rather than explicitly calling spin_lock_init().

diff --git a/net/wireless/reg.c b/net/wireless/reg.c
index 21536c48deec..1c14f4d30344 100644
--- a/net/wireless/reg.c
+++ b/net/wireless/reg.c
@@ -126,7 +126,7 @@ static int reg_num_devs_support_basehint;
  * is relevant for all registered devices.
  */
 static bool reg_is_indoor;
-static spinlock_t reg_indoor_lock;
+static DEFINE_SPINLOCK(reg_indoor_lock);
 
 /* Used to track the userspace process controlling the indoor setting */
 static u32 reg_is_indoor_portid;
@@ -210,11 +210,11 @@ static struct regulatory_request *get_last_request(void)
 
 /* Used to queue up regulatory hints */
 static LIST_HEAD(reg_requests_list);
-static spinlock_t reg_requests_lock;
+static DEFINE_SPINLOCK(reg_requests_lock);
 
 /* Used to queue up beacon hints for review */
 static LIST_HEAD(reg_pending_beacons);
-static spinlock_t reg_pending_beacons_lock;
+static DEFINE_SPINLOCK(reg_pending_beacons_lock);
 
 /* Used to keep track of processed beacon hints */
 static LIST_HEAD(reg_beacon_list);
@@ -4262,10 +4262,6 @@ int __init regulatory_init(void)
 	if (IS_ERR(reg_pdev))
 		return PTR_ERR(reg_pdev);
 
-	spin_lock_init(&reg_requests_lock);
-	spin_lock_init(&reg_pending_beacons_lock);
-	spin_lock_init(&reg_indoor_lock);
-
 	rcu_assign_pointer(cfg80211_regdomain, cfg80211_world_regdom);
 
 	user_alpha2[0] = '9';
